On the other hand, China car companies have not made substantial progress like Toyota, Hyundai and Honda. At the 20 14 Shanghai Auto Show, SAIC released the fourth generation Roewe 950 plug-in fuel cell vehicle with a maximum cruising range of 400km. In 20 16, Chery exhibited an Arrizo 3 fuel cell extended-range electric vehicle at the National Twelfth Five-Year Scientific and Technological Innovation Exhibition, which can achieve a battery life of 350km in the extended-range mode. However, this is only a technical demonstration of SAIC and Chery.
With the coming of 2020, the different actions of China car companies in the field of h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ars make people feel a wave of "small climax" in the industry.
In less than a month, three vehicle companies have successively released plans for h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ars, and put forward plans for mass production vehicles. On July 20th, Great Wall Motor released the "Lemon" platform. The "Lemon" platform model will match the second generation hydrogen fuel cell power system, and the driving range can reach 1 100km. According to the plan, Great Wall Motor's first hydrogen fuel vehicle platform will be launched this year, a small-scale hydrogen energy fleet will be displayed in 2022, and a mature fuel cell passenger car model will be launched in 2023.
"Guangzhou Automobile New Energy Aion? LX? Fuel? Cell made its debut at Guangzhou Automotive Technology Day. "
Guangzhou automobile is also close behind. On July 28th, Aion, Guangzhou Automobile's first hydrogen fuel cell vehicle? LX? Fuel? Cell made its debut at Guangzhou Automotive Technology Day. This model is more than just a demonstration car. GAC plans to put it into demonstration operation this year.
Among the new forces to build cars, there are also fans of fuel cell technology. On August 10, Aichi Automobile held the groundbreaking ceremony of methanol reforming hydrogen fuel cell technology in Gaoping, Shanxi Province, and its methanol hydrogen fuel cell power system production base officially started. With an investment of 2 billion yuan, the plant can achieve an annual output of 80,000 units/set of fuel cell power system for hydrogen production from methanol.
In addition to the above-mentioned enterprises, according to preliminary statistics, companies such as Haima, Du Yun, Hongqi, SAIC Datong and Chang 'an have also begun to deploy in the field of hydrogen fuel cell vehicles. It can be said that from the layout of h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ars, there are currently the largest number of domestic car companies. In fact, China car companies have never ignored the development of hydrogen fuel cell vehicles. Since 2008, China car companies have been investing in h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ars. SAIC, Chery, FAW, BAIC, Great Wall, Aichi and other automobile companies all exhibited fuel cell passenger car products. According to preliminary statistics, since 2008, more than 20 kinds of fuel cell passenger cars have appeared in the domestic market.
It is also an indisputable fact that China's hydrogen fuel cell automobile industry is concentrated in the commercial vehicle field. Professor Zhang Tong, director of the Institute of Fuel Cell Vehicle Technology of Tongji University, explained that from a technical point of view, it is relatively difficult to develop commercial vehicles when the fuel cell vehicle industry chain technology is not mature. Passenger cars have higher requirements on the technical maturity of related parts and it is more difficult to push forward.
Another reason lies in the national policy orientation. The demonstration operation of hydrogen fuel cell vehicles focuses on public transportation and logistics. From the perspective of subsidies, it is easier for the state to control and operate. Coupled with the intervention of local government forces, regional and public buses have become the key support targets.
Therefore, some people think that passenger cars in China are more suitable for pure electric technology, and there is no need to develop h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ars.
This view is biased. Judging from the proportion of commercial vehicles and passenger cars, as of June 2020, the number of cars in China has reached 270 million, of which only 29.44 million are trucks. Even with public transport, the proportion of commercial vehicles is not high.
If the hydrogen fuel cell automobile industry only extends to commercial vehicles, the overall market capacity will be very limited, which is far from enough to contribute to energy conservation and emission reduction in China. ■? Where is the bottleneck of hydrogen fuel cell passenger car?
Of course, it is not easy to develop h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ars.
Daimler recently announced the termination of the research and development plan for h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ars. This means that this project, which started from 20 13 and cooperated with Ford and Nissan, has stopped. The core reason why Daimler abandoned the fuel cell project is that the cost of manufacturing h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ars is too high.
The first problem of h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ars is the cost. As a consumer-oriented product, the price of passenger cars is an important reason to decide their purchase. Some organizations have made preliminary statistics on the cost of hydrogen fuel cell vehicles. The price of fuel cell vehicles is 0.5 to 2 times that of 65438+ lithium ion electric vehicles and 3 to 4 times that of fuel vehicles. If the cost of h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ars remains high, it is difficult to have a market in the future.
Infrastructure is the second obstacle for hydrogen fuel cell passenger cars. If the layout of hydrogen refueling stations is insufficient in the future, will there be charging difficulties similar to pure electric vehicles? Up to now, China has operated 59 hydrogen refueling stations, 53 hydrogen refueling stations are under construction, and 20 hydrogen refueling stations are planned to be built. The promotion is very slow.
Of course, technical problems can not be ignored. Ma Tiancai, an associate professor at Tongji University Automotive College, said that from the perspective of industrial chain, the development of hydrogen fuel cells in China is not much different from that of foreign vehicles and systems, but the key materials at the bottom are relatively weak.
For example, the stack accounts for more than 25% of the total cost of the hydrogen fuel cell system, and its core materials almost all depend on foreign manufacturers; In the field of catalysts, domestic consumption is 3-5 times that of foreign countries, and mainly comes from foreign enterprises, and only a few domestic enterprises can produce in small batches; In addition, proton exchange membranes and membrane electrodes are mainly supplied by foreign enterprises.
However, we believe that the hydrogen fuel cell passenger car industry has ushered in spring. Qi Lin, Chairman and CEO of Shanghai Remodeling Energy Technology Co., Ltd., roughly divides the development of global fuel cell vehicles into three stages:
The first stage is the development stage of fuel cell passenger cars, including the development of fuel cell technology led by Toyota, Honda, Mercedes-Benz and other passenger car companies, which laid a good foundation for the development of fuel cell technology and achieved many technical breakthroughs.
The second stage is the development stage of fuel cell commercial vehicles. In the past three or four years, fuel cell commercial vehicles have maintained rapid growth in the global scope, especially in the China market. Whether it is a vehicle enterprise or a component enterprise, everyone has gradually turned their goals and future to the direction of commercial vehicles with long battery life and high load.
The third stage, that is, from 2020, is the beginning of a new journey for fuel cell vehicles. The development trend of hydrogen energy application in the world is gradually clear, and the commercialization scene is gradually realized, and it is in the process of continuous development.
Why is the development of hydrogen fuel cell vehicles moving towards a new stage? Qi Lin explained it from four dimensions. The first dimension is that shell, BP, Sinopec, PetroChina and other energy-end enterprises enter the hydrogen energy industry and start infrastructure construction. The second dimension is that from the product side, many mainstream automobile companies and parts companies have also started product planning; The third dimension is that from the application scenario, more and more hydrogen energy commercialization companies have also entered the market; The fourth dimension comes from government policies and support plans.
